What strange devices? And what distant West? Or is it East? Find out as we go on location to the Berkeley Rep where a good time—if mysterious—is always had.

The play Concerning Strange Devices from the West is a world premiere now playing at the Rep. Created by playwright Naomi Iizuka, it creatively explores the impact the camera (aka freeze frame, several of them) had on 1800s Japan as well as the present time.

Artistic director Tony Taccone writes, “Marshalling the full force of her considerable intellect and imagination, Naomi leads us into the heart of mystery behind every photograph. We travel to 19th-century Japan, where photographers are exploiting the desire of Victorian Westerners to purchase photographs of exotic geishas, as if by doing so their own lives become more exotic. From there we move to modern-day Tokyo, where the same photographs reveal a host of secrets and relationships that raise much larger questions: What is real? What do we imagine as real? What do we need to be real?”
